Period Worked Time Off Vacation Pay. Less than 1 yr 2 weeks 4% 1 yr but less than 5 yrs 2 weeks 4% 5 yrs but less than 9 yrs 3 weeks 6% 10 yrs but less than 14 yrs 4 weeks 8% Vacation pay shall be based on annual gross earnings. Vacation week A week for the purpose of vacation entitlement is understood to mean a set number of days and hours equivalent to an employee's regular working schedule averaged over the two (1) week pay period less call-ins and overtime.
